Nick Chubb, Myles Garrett among 5 permanent captains for Cleveland Browns in 2022

It's the first time the team has had permanent captains since head coach Kevin Stefanski took over in 2020. An additional captain will be named each week.

BEREA, Ohio — The Cleveland Browns are bringing back a time-honored football tradition.

For the first time since head coach Kevin Stefanski took over in 2020, the players have voted on five permanent captains for the upcoming season — two on offense, two on defense, and one on special teams. The designated "leaders" are:

  • OG Joel Bitonio
  • RB Nick Chubb
  • DE Myles Garrett
  • LB Anthony Walker Jr.
  • LS Charley Hughlett

"I always think it's a big deal when the team votes, when your teammates vote for you," Stefanski told reporters in Berea on Wednesday. "I think that says a lot. I think those guys are all great leaders in their own way and will provide great leadership for this team."

During Stefanski's first two years, the Browns eschewed permanent captains in favor of ones selected prior to each game, and the coach says the club will continue that practice with an additional captain week-to-week. The last time Cleveland had full-season captains was during Freddie Kitchens' lone campaign in 2019, when Hughlett joined then-quarterback Baker Mayfield and linebacker Christian Kirksey in getting the revered "C".

Members of the media noted how Stefanski was "not big on team captains" in the past, but the coach downplayed that, explaining that he's been a part of teams in both situations before and that his first season in 2020 was "unique" due to the COVID-19 pandemic. He also stressed that these five individuals don't have to be the only leaders in the locker room.

"You don't need a 'C' on your chest to be a leader. You just don't," Stefanski said. "I think leadership comes from a bunch of areas of your football team, but I do think it says a lot about those players, those players that would represent us before the game and go out there. It says a lot about who you are."

Indeed, this year's captain selections should come as a surprise to no one: Bitonio and Hughlett are both the longest-tenured Browns, and Chubb and Garrett might be their best players on each side of the ball. Walker has only been in Cleveland since last year, but has quickly ingratiated himself as one of the on-field leaders of the defense.

The Browns kick off the season this Sunday in Carolina, where former captain Mayfield will lead the Carolina Panthers at QB.
